EKM7DC is a solar photovoltaic-specific molded case circuit breaker developed by ETEK Electric, compliant with the IEC 60947-2 standard. It features a rated working voltage of up to DC1500V, a rated insulation voltage of 1500V, a rated impulse withstand voltage of 12kV, and a rated current range of 100A to 1600A. These circuit-breakers are capable of breaking short-circuit currents up to 20kA in 1500V DC voltage applications.
Widely used in the main circuits of combiner boxes, DC cabinets, and inverter cabinets, the EKM7DC provides short-circuit protection, overload protection, and isolation functions. This helps prevent system failures caused by current from other circuits passing through short-circuit points. Its compact size, easy installation, safety, reliable operation, and high cost-effectiveness make it well-suited for the needs of photovoltaic power generation.
